This Career Advancement Programme in Decision Theory Modeling equips professionals with advanced skills in quantitative analysis and strategic decision-making. Participants will learn to build and apply sophisticated models to solve complex real-world problems across diverse industries.
Key learning outcomes include mastering various decision-making frameworks, proficiency in statistical software packages for data analysis, and developing expertise in building and interpreting decision trees, Bayesian networks, and other relevant modeling techniques. This includes hands-on experience with Monte Carlo simulations and sensitivity analysis.
The programme's duration is typically six months, delivered through a blended learning approach combining online modules, workshops, and case study analyses. This flexible format caters to working professionals seeking to enhance their career prospects.
Industry relevance is paramount. Graduates will be equipped to tackle challenges in areas like risk management, operations research, finance, consulting, and supply chain optimization.
